Default Outlook 2002 not sending

It takes forever to have an email message sent unless I press "Send Receive"
I have Outlook set to do send/receive every minute when online and when off
line...but it still will not send immediately when I try to send an email I
have just finished and pressed "Send" for....it just sits in the Outbox...I
do not get any error message and when I manually press "Send/Receive", it
finally goes...what is wrong? I have Outlook 2002 and XP.

Default Outlook 2002 not sending

"Smitty" wrote in message
...

It takes forever to have an email message sent unless I press "Send
Receive"


Do you have "Send immediately when connected" selected in ToolsOptionsMail
Setup?

I have Outlook set to do send/receive every minute when online and when
off
line..


WAY too short. The send/.receive interval shouldn't be less than about ten
minutes. Also, if you have your antivirus program configured to scan mail,
uninstall it and reinstall it without the mail scanning feature.
